Node.js 的文件限制 fs-lock

BSD
JavaScript
跨平台
Yahoo
2015-05-07
孔小菜

fs-lock 是 Node.js的文件限制,用纯 JavaScript 写成,用户可以加载其他方法获取访问。

示例代码:

//Do your startup code here, then lock it down with:
require('fs-lock')({    
'file_accessdir': [ __dirname, '/tmp' ],    
'open_basedir': [ '/usr/local/share/node_modules', __dirname ]
});var fs = require('fs');

fs.readFile('/etc/passwd', function(err, data) {    
//this will throw an Access Denied error});
加载中

评论(0)

暂无评论

暂无资讯

暂无问答

Linux 虚拟文件系统概览

Linux内核文档翻译,来源于linux-3.16.3/Documentation/filesystems/vfs.txt,采用分段中英并列的方式,黄色标注表示对原文意思不确定的部分 (未完)...

2015/04/01 23:22
20
0
块设备驱动注意事项

今天在编译和测试块设备驱动时,遇到了一些问题,主要是内核在2.6.10转到2.6.32(redhat6.3)时,块设备子系统的接口已经发生了很大变化,包括一些结构定义和函数,该问题会导致编译失败,强制...

2014/01/20 18:05
681
0
Rsyncd的Linux服务文件写法

Rsyncd的Linux服务文件写法 #! /bin/sh # rsynctools init file for rsyncd # Copyright (C) 2002-4 Zhang Hui<zhangh@oec-h.com> # $Id$ # For RedHat and cousins: # chkconfig: - 99 01 ...

2016/08/12 00:59
11
0
进程间通信记录

FIFO命名管道 Once you have created a FIFO special file in this way, any process can open it for reading or writing, in the same way as an ordinary file. However, it has to be op...

2013/08/21 11:51
18
0
The Virtual Filesystem (Linux)

The Virtual Filesystem Linux manages to support multiple filesystem types through a concept called virtual filesystem. The key idea behind the virtual filesystem is to put a wid...

2012/06/04 12:04
135
0
Intel 80x86指令前缀码

Intel 80x86指令前缀码

2016/12/01 06:22
58
1
内核线程

内核线程可以用户两种方法实现: 1. 古老的方法 创建内核线程: ret = kernel_thread(mykthread, NULL, CLONE_FS | CLONE_FILES | CLONE_SIGHAND | SIGCHLD); 内核线程方法的实现 static DEC...

2014/05/12 21:29
7
0

没有更多内容

加载失败,请刷新页面

返回顶部
顶部